智能语音交互:从技术原理到场景落地的全链路解析
2026.04.16 19:36浏览量:0简介:本文深度解析智能语音交互的核心技术架构、应用场景及优化方向,帮助开发者掌握从算法选型到系统落地的关键能力,并探讨未来技术演进趋势。通过技术拆解与场景案例,揭示如何构建低延迟、高鲁棒性的智能语音系统。
一、智能语音交互的技术架构解析
智能语音交互系统由前端声学处理、语音识别、自然语言理解、对话管理四大核心模块构成,形成完整的”感知-认知-决策”技术链条。
- 前端声学处理
作为语音交互的第一道关卡,声学处理需解决三大挑战:
- 波束成形技术:通过麦克风阵列的空间滤波特性,抑制非目标方向的噪声干扰。典型应用场景如车载系统需实现360度声源定位,某主流方案采用7麦克风环形阵列,结合波束成形算法可将信噪比提升12dB以上。
- 语音活动检测(VAD):精准识别语音起始/结束点,减少无效计算。某行业常见技术方案采用基于深度神经网络的VAD模型,在60dB噪声环境下仍能保持98%的检测准确率。
- 回声消除(AEC):在扬声器播放场景下消除设备自身回声,某开源框架采用NLMS自适应滤波算法,回声抑制比可达40dB。
语音识别引擎
当前主流架构采用Conformer模型,其融合卷积神经网络(CNN)的局部特征提取能力与Transformer的全局建模优势:# 伪代码示例:Conformer模型核心结构class ConformerBlock(nn.Module):def __init__(self, dim, ff_mult=4):super().__init__()self.ffn1 = FeedForward(dim, dim*ff_mult)self.conv = ConvModule(dim) # 包含Depthwise Conv + GLU激活self.self_attn = MultiHeadAttention(dim)self.ffn2 = FeedForward(dim, dim*ff_mult)self.norm = nn.LayerNorm(dim)
该架构在LibriSpeech数据集上实现5.8%的词错误率(WER),较传统RNN模型提升37%。端到端建模方案通过联合优化声学模型与语言模型,显著降低级联误差。
自然语言理解(NLU)
基于BERT的意图识别模型成为行业标配,其双向Transformer编码器可捕捉上下文语义特征。某改进方案通过知识蒸馏将参数量从110M压缩至12M,在保持98%准确率的同时,推理延迟降低82%。典型处理流程包含:
- 文本归一化(数字/符号转换)
- 领域分类(如医疗/家居场景识别)
- 意图解析(命令型/问答型区分)
- 槽位填充(提取关键参数)
- 对话管理系统
采用状态跟踪与策略学习分离的架构设计,通过有限状态机(FSM)或深度强化学习(DRL)实现多轮对话控制。某开源框架提供可视化对话流程编辑器,支持业务人员通过拖拽方式配置复杂对话逻辑。
二、典型应用场景与技术挑战
智能家居控制
需解决远场识别(5米以上)与方言适配问题。某行业方案通过多通道融合技术,在混响时间0.6s的客厅环境中仍保持92%的识别准确率。设备控制指令需满足实时性要求,端到端延迟需控制在300ms以内。医疗问诊系统
电子病历语音录入需达到99.5%以上的准确率,并支持医学术语的精准识别。某系统采用领域自适应技术,在300小时医学语料上微调后,专业术语识别错误率下降63%。车载交互系统
面临高噪声(85dB以上)与多语种合成需求。某方案通过骨传导麦克风技术,在发动机噪声环境下仍能清晰捕捉驾驶员指令。多语种合成采用Tacotron2架构,支持中英混合语音的流畅输出。智慧城市应用
在公共交通场景中,需实现高并发(1000+并发请求)与低延迟(<200ms)的语音服务。某系统采用边缘计算架构,将模型部署在基站侧,减少云端传输延迟。
三、技术优化方向与未来趋势
多模态交互融合
通过视觉-语音-手势的跨模态感知提升系统鲁棒性。某研究机构提出基于Transformer的跨模态编码器,在噪声环境下通过唇动识别将识别准确率提升15个百分点。隐私保护增强
采用联邦学习技术实现模型训练的数据不出域。某框架支持在本地设备完成特征提取,仅上传加密后的梯度信息,满足GDPR等隐私法规要求。边缘计算部署
将轻量化模型部署至终端设备,降低云端依赖。某方案通过模型量化技术将BERT模型压缩至3MB,在树莓派4B上实现15FPS的实时推理。工业场景深化
在设备巡检场景中,结合骨传导麦克风与AR眼镜实现免提操作。某系统通过振动信号增强技术,在90dB工业噪声环境下仍保持85%的识别率。个性化学习助手
构建用户画像驱动的动态适应系统。某教育产品通过分析用户发音特征,自动调整语音识别模型的声学参数,使非母语者的识别准确率提升28%。
四、开发者实践建议
- 算法选型策略
- 资源受限场景:优先选择CRNN或QuartzNet等轻量模型
- 高精度需求:采用Conformer+Transformer的混合架构
- 多语种支持:使用XLSR-53等跨语言预训练模型
- 性能优化技巧
- 模型量化:将FP32参数转为INT8,推理速度提升3-4倍
- 内存优化:采用内存复用技术,减少中间结果存储
- 并发处理:使用异步IO与线程池提升吞吐量
- 测试评估体系
建立包含以下维度的测试矩阵:
| 测试项 | 指标要求 | 测试方法 |
|———————|————————————|————————————|
| 识别准确率 | WER<8% | 交叉验证集测试 |
| 响应延迟 | P99<200ms | 压力测试工具模拟并发 |
| 噪声鲁棒性 | SNR=5dB时WER<15% | 白噪声/工厂噪声注入 |
| 方言适配 | 覆盖8大方言区 | 方言语料专项测试 |
智能语音交互技术正经历从感知智能向认知智能的跃迁,开发者需持续关注模型轻量化、多模态融合等方向的技术突破。通过合理的架构设计与持续优化,可构建出满足工业级应用需求的智能语音系统,为各行业数字化转型提供核心交互能力支撑。

发表评论
登录后可评论,请前往 登录 或 注册